Show Notes

The Malouf Foundation exists to confront child sexual exploitation, specifically sex trafficking and online abuse, and is supported in its efforts by Malouf Companies. In this episode, the Director of Operations, Aniko Mahan, explains the foundation's different programs and initiatives. Aniko and Elizabeth focus specifically on Raise, a new app about to launch that help parents teach their children to use social media safely, and Malouf's OnWatch training, a free, one-hour training that helps bystanders recognize human trafficking.
